Top 3 Emotional Processing Rituals from Mutual Breakup Reddit Threads

The first ritual frequently mentioned in mutual breakup Reddit discussions is the "Letter You'll Never Send" technique. This practice involves writing an honest, unfiltered letter to your ex-partner expressing everything you wish you could say – the good, the bad, and the complicated. The crucial element that makes this mutual breakup Reddit tip effective is that you don't actually send the letter. Instead, many Reddit users recommend a symbolic release – some burn it, others bury it, creating a physical representation of letting go.

Another powerful practice shared across mutual breakup Reddit communities is creating a "Relationship Timeline" visualization. This exercise involves mapping your relationship from beginning to end, noting both beautiful memories and challenging moments. Users on mutual breakup Reddit forums report that seeing the relationship's complete arc helps provide perspective and reduces anxiety about the decision to part ways. The timeline serves as a reminder that the relationship had a natural conclusion, rather than an abrupt ending.

The third ritual, the "5-5-5 Emotional Release" method, appears frequently in mutual breakup Reddit advice threads. This technique involves setting aside three five-minute blocks throughout your day: five minutes to acknowledge sadness, five minutes to express gratitude for what the relationship taught you, and five minutes to envision your future. This structured approach to emotional processing has become a mutual breakup Reddit favorite because it honors conflicting feelings without allowing any single emotion to dominate.

2 Identity-Rebuilding Practices from Mutual Breakup Reddit Communities

Beyond processing emotions, mutual breakup Reddit users emphasize the importance of rebuilding your individual identity. The "Rediscovery Map" technique stands out as particularly effective. This practice involves creating a visual representation of who you were before the relationship, what parts of yourself you may have compromised during it, and who you want to become now. Many mutual breakup Reddit participants report that this exercise helps them recognize how much of themselves they may have inadvertently set aside to accommodate the relationship.

The final ritual that appears consistently in mutual breakup Reddit guidance is the "Future Self Visualization" exercise. This practice involves regularly setting aside time to imagine your life six months, one year, and five years in the future, focusing on goals and experiences that excite you independently of a relationship. What makes this mutual breakup Reddit strategy especially powerful is how it redirects your emotional energy from the past toward a future filled with possibility.
